Transaction 7b32028090ba703f32fe78ffbe2c36352d7b874d723baccbb305fc5cbaebd912
1 Input
1 Output
-
7b32028090ba703f32fe78ffbe2c36352d7b874d723baccbb305fc5cbaebd912:0
- value
- 1052380955
- script pubkey
- OP_0 OP_PUSHBYTES_20 8ed405a2f0c3d04e58a9cee4eaad013f8ae7d0a6
- address
- bc1q3m2qtghsc0gyuk9femjw4tgp879w059xqshdtu